
Cardi B Expresses Concern About Her Kids' Drive and Work Ethic
January 31, 2025: Rapper Cardi B recently shared her biggest concern about her children with ex-husband Offset—Kulture, 6, Wave, 3, and their four-month-old baby girl. The star opened up on her Instagram Stories, revealing that her main fear is that her kids might not develop the strong drive she holds dear.
“My biggest fear is my kids not having that DRIVE,” Cardi wrote, adding, “IDGAF what you wanna do!! MAKE A BILLION DOLLARS OUT OF IT!”
Having faced many challenges in her own career, Cardi is deeply aware of the importance of a strong work ethic. After rising to fame in 2015 on Love & Hip Hop: New York and becoming a global rap sensation with her breakout single “Bodak Yellow” in 2017, Cardi understands the hustle required to succeed in the entertainment industry.
In an interview in Singapore in 2022, Cardi shared that although her kids will never experience the struggle she faced, she still wants them to appreciate hard work. “They need to know to never feel comfortable,” she said. “Don’t ever feel like, ‘I’m going to get it because I’m Cardi and Offset’s kid.'”
While her kids may not know hardship, Cardi is determined that they learn the value of earning their achievements: “Even though my kids are well-off, I want them to know that when you work for things and achieve it, it’s more respected…”
